153 Whalley New Road

    153, WHALLEY NEW ROAD, BLACKBURN, BB1 9TL

    This terraced leasehold property on Whalley New Road last sold in May 2017 for £91,500. Based on price growth in the BB1 district since then, its estimated current value is £126,732 — placing it in the 8th percentile nationally and the 38th percentile within BB1. The property covers 110 m² (1,184 sq ft), giving an estimated value of £1,152 per m². The EPC rating is D, with a potential rating of D.

    District Context — BB1

    BB1 covers Blackburn town centre and surrounding inner-city neighbourhoods in Lancashire, positioned at the heart of East Lancashire's urban landscape. The area is characterised by strong community ties, affordable housing, and a diverse economic base rooted in retail, services, and skilled trades.
